Preparing Viral Coefficient Optimization for Seasonal Cycles

Understanding the media-entertainment calendar is critical. Design teams often ramp up work before major releases—film launches, game updates, streaming events. Sales pros should map viral campaigns around these bursts. Pre-season prep means crafting incentives and referral flows that sync with customers’ heightened activity and collaboration.

Start by segmenting your user base by project timelines. Those engaged in high-demand periods need streamlined sharing tools embedded in your design platform, enabling quick invite sends or asset exchanges. Off-season, focus shifts. Viral growth tactics become nurturing campaigns, supporting smaller projects and community growth until the next peak.

A 2024 Forrester report highlights that companies integrating viral loops with seasonal user behavior see a 15% lift in referral-based sign-ups during peak cycles. Ignoring this alignment leads to wasted outreach and poor ROI measurement.

Peak Period Strategies: Maximize Viral Impact in Media-Entertainment

During peak production, speed and relevance matter. Sales teams should push referral campaigns that tie directly into current projects—e.g., exclusive templates or plugins unlocked when users invite peers. Keep messaging tight and contextual.

Use data from tools like Zigpoll to survey users on what incentives spark sharing during crunch times. A studio team once increased invites by 300% during a film edit cycle by offering limited-time asset packs for each referral.

Be aware, HIPAA compliance can restrict data sharing if your platform interfaces with healthcare content or private personnel info in media productions. This means viral tools must avoid harvesting health data or require advanced anonymization. The downside is more complex onboarding flows, but compliance keeps partnerships intact.

Off-Season Viral Strategies: Maintain Momentum and Prepare

When projects slow, viral coefficient optimization ROI measurement in media-entertainment shifts to retention and re-engagement. Sales efforts should focus on community-building and feedback loops using surveys like Zigpoll, SurveyMonkey, or Typeform to understand off-season user needs.

Nurture dormant users with invite bonuses unrelated to project deadlines—think beta access or feature previews. These keep the viral loop warm until the next big production wave. The drawback here is slower viral growth but steadier baseline engagement.

viral coefficient optimization ROI measurement in media-entertainment: Tracking Success

Measuring viral coefficient ROI is about tying referrals and user invites to actual revenue influenced through seasonal peaks. Use tracking mechanisms integrated into your CRM and analytics platforms, ensuring you segment data by season and campaign type.

Pay attention to key metrics: invite acceptance rate, time to referral, and downstream usage of referred accounts. A case study from a design-tools company showed they moved from a viral coefficient of 0.8 to 1.3 after instituting seasonal referral timing and precise ROI tracking.

For improved accuracy, combine behavioral data with customer feedback gathered via tools like Zigpoll. This triangulation uncovers not just if viral loops work but why they succeed or fail across seasonal phases.

viral coefficient optimization metrics that matter for media-entertainment?

Focus on these:

  • Viral coefficient itself (number of new users per existing user)
  • Invite conversion rate (invite sent vs. accepted)
  • Time to first action (how quickly a referred user starts using the tool)
  • Seasonal engagement lift (referral growth compared across production cycles)
  • Compliance adherence metrics (audit logs, anonymization checks in HIPAA contexts)

These metrics, combined with ongoing user feedback via Zigpoll or similar, create a feedback loop for iterative viral campaign refinement.
